The Thirty Meter Telescope (TMT) protests were a series of protests and demonstrations that began on the Island of Hawaii over the choosing of Mauna Kea for the site location of the Thirty Meter Telescope. Mauna Kea is the most sacred dormant volcano of Native Hawaiian religion and culture, and in Kānaka Maoli (Native Hawaiian) tradition is home to the sky god Wākea and other gods. Protests began locally within the state of Hawaii on October 7, 2014 but went global within weeks of the April 2, 2015 arrest of 31 people who had blockaded the roadway to keep construction crews off the summit. Thousands later joined when attempts were made to restart construction. The TMT, a $1.4 billion ground-based, large segmented mirror reflecting telescope grew from astronomers' prioritization in 2000 of a thirty-meter telescope to be built within the decade. Mauna Kea was announced as TMT's preferred site in 2009. Opposition to the project began shortly after the announcement of Mauna Kea as the chosen site out of 5 proposals. While opposition against the observatories on Mauna Kea has been ongoing since the first telescope, built by the University of Hawaii, this protest may be the most vocal. The project was expected to be completed by 2024, nearly simultaneously with the 39-meter Extremely Large Telescope being built in Chile; however, on December 2, 2015, the Supreme Court of Hawaii invalidated the TMT's building permits. The court ruled that due process was not followed. The TMT corporation then removed all construction equipment and vehicles from Mauna Kea, and re-applied for a new permit, meant to respect the Supreme Court's ruling. This was granted on September 28, 2018. On October 30, 2018, the Court validated the new construction permit. The controversy has led to considerable division in the local community with residents choosing support or opposition. Notable native Hawaiian supporters include Peter Apo, sitting trustee of the Office of Hawaiian Affairs, and leading University of Hawaii professor and astronomer the late Dr. Paul Coleman, who in 2015 said "Hawaiians are just so tied to astronomy I cannot, in any stretch of the imagination, think that TMT is something that our ancestors wouldn't just jump on and embrace". In July 2019, 300 protestors gathered in support of the TMT project outside the Hawaii State Capitol in Honolulu. Notable opponents include Office of Hawaiian Affairs trustee for Hawai'i Mililani Trask, Native Hawaiian actor Jason Momoa, Samoan actor Dwayne Johnson, and practitioners of traditional Hawaiian culture and religion. In early 2020, the protests and attempts at construction were halted by the onset of the COVID-19 pandemic. No construction has resumed as of 2024, and management of the mountaintop is being transferred to a new oversight authority with representatives of both astronomers and Native Hawaiian communities. In June 2025, the National Science Foundation dropped support for the TMT in favor of the Giant Magellan Telescope. Although the international consortium of scientists behind the TMT plans to press on, this loss of funding means the telescope may never be built.

== Background ==

=== Development of Mauna Kea observatories === After studying photos for NASA's Apollo program that contained greater detail than any ground based telescope, Gerard Kuiper began seeking an arid site for infrared studies. While he first began looking in Chile, he also made the decision to perform tests in the Hawaiian Islands. Tests on Maui's Haleakalā were promising but the mountain was too low in the inversion layer and often covered by clouds. On the "Big Island" of Hawaii, Mauna Kea is considered the highest island mountain in the world, measuring roughly 33,000 feet from the base deep under the Pacific Ocean. While the summit is often covered with snow the air itself is extremely dry. Kuiper began looking into the possibility of an observatory on Mauna Kea. After testing, he discovered the low humidity was perfect for infrared signals. He persuaded then-governor John A. Burns, to bulldoze a dirt road to the summit where he built a small telescope on Puʻu Poliʻahu, a cinder cone peak. The peak was the second highest on the mountain with the highest peak being holy ground, so Kuiper avoided it. Next, Kuiper tried enlisting NASA to fund a larger facility with a large telescope, housing and other needed structures. NASA, in turn decided to make the project open to competition. Professor of physics John Jefferies of the University of Hawaii placed a bid on behalf of the university. Jefferies had gained his reputation through observations at Sacramento Peak Observatory. The proposal was for a two-meter telescope to serve both the needs of NASA and the university. While large telescopes are not ordinarily awarded to universities without well established astronomers, Jefferies and UH were awarded the NASA contract, infuriating Kuiper who felt that "his mountain" had been "stolen" from "him". Kuiper would abandon his site (the very first telescope on Mauna Kea) over the competition and begin work in Arizona on a different NASA project. After considerable testing by Jefferies' team, the best locations were determined to be near the summit at the top of the cinder cones. Testing also determined Mauna Kea to be superb for nighttime viewing due to many factors including the thin air, constant trade winds and being surrounded by sea. Jefferies would build a 2.24 meter telescope with the State of Hawaii agreeing to build a reliable, all weather roadway to the summit. Building began in 1967 and first light seen in 1970.
